- [ ] Step 7: Archive cold storage buckets (Glacierline tier). Confirm both ceremony witnesses are present, verify bucket manifests match the Oxbow ledger, then seal the archive key shares. Plugin authors may observe but not handle shares. Once sealed, the archive index itself is encrypted and can only be reopened with the passphrase below.

vault phrase of badup-hahig = tamael-aldael-kelmir-istael-fenok-istwyn-tamius-jorath-oliion

**Ticket #4412 — Lingopull extraction script failing on auth**

Hey on-call — the nightly run of `lingopull-extract` started 401ing last night, so no new translation strings made it into the Phrasedock queue. Turns out the service credential it uses expired Tuesday and nobody got the calendar nag (thanks, Marza's old reminder bot). I've already minted a fresh credential against the Phrasedock staging tenant and confirmed a manual run passes. Just swap it into the runner config and re-trigger the job. Here's the new key:

app token of tadug-yahag = vxb3-949

Subject: Pooler tweak going out tonight

Hey folks — we're shipping a small change to the Copperline connection pooler this evening. Max idle connections drop from 40 to 25 per service, which should stop the nightly saturation alarms on the Tidemark cluster. If you see connection-wait spikes after rollout, just bump the limit back and ping the data platform channel. The release build token is below.

pipeline stamp: htk3_a71

## Changelog — Pictovault 1.9.3

Fixed the image-cache memory leak (evictions never fired under burst load). As part of the fix, IMG_CACHE_TOKEN was renamed to CACHE_EVICTOR_SECRET; old name is dead, no alias. Release manager: rotate the credential during deploy since the leak may have logged the old one. Put the new value on the following line.

sealed setting: VAULT_KEY20=c8ea1e419912889df6b4